Output 072c493214125da6260909c0865102268a922f179ad7bae42fe9658728d63f4e:36

value
38851019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d724be85ab5461258fc595c8fa69a5980d3e5e OP_EQUAL
address
MMvbMDREtZMKNjCAHzFBjsPMWopBHH8Lkb
transaction
072c493214125da6260909c0865102268a922f179ad7bae42fe9658728d63f4e
spent
true